🎯 Understanding Blood Sugar Reversal: What Does It Mean?

First things first – what exactly does "reversing blood sugar" mean? In simple terms, it means getting your blood glucose levels back to a healthy range after dealing with issues like prediabetes or type 2 diabetes. This often involves lifestyle changes such as exercise, weight loss, and most importantly, dietary adjustments. 💪🥗

🍴 Can You Return to Normal Eating Habits?

Now for the million-dollar question: Can you eat whatever you want after reversing blood sugar? Spoiler alert – probably not. While some flexibility may come your way, "normal" eating might need a new definition. Here’s why:
-

Your body has been through a lot. Imagine training a puppy to sit – if you let it jump all over again, it’ll forget its manners. Your metabolism works similarly!


-

Sugar and processed carbs are sneaky little devils. They can creep back in and undo all your hard work faster than you can say "donut." 🍩❌


Instead, focus on creating sustainable habits that keep your blood sugar stable. Think more veggies, lean proteins, whole grains, and fewer sugary surprises. 🥗🍗🌾

💡 Practical Tips for Staying on Track

Here’s how to maintain your newfound blood sugar balance without feeling deprived:
-

**Meal Prep Like a Pro:** Plan meals ahead so you’re less tempted by fast food or vending machines. 📆🍳


-

**Treat Yourself Wisely:** Occasional indulgences are okay, but choose wisely. Swap regular ice cream for frozen yogurt or berries with whipped cream. 🍦➡️🍓


-

**Stay Active:** Movement keeps your insulin sensitivity high, making it easier to manage blood sugar. Dance parties count too! 💃🕺


Remember, maintaining good blood sugar control isn’t about perfection – it’s about progress. Even small wins add up over time!
